Figma Make enables teams to go from prompt to production code, and the Figma agent is a purpose-built design agent that edits files directly on the Figma canvas.
We're looking for deeply technical Product Managers to own the AI Platform that powers Make and the agent: the distributed developer systems behind Figma Make, the agent infrastructure that integrates frontier models and MCP servers, the eval platform that drives continuous quality across our AI suite, and the context platform that personalizes AI outputs to customers' design systems. These roles sit at the intersection of product and infrastructure. If you're excited about developer tooling, systems thinking, and building the foundations that other product teams ship on top of, this role is for you. These are full time roles that can be held from one of our US hubs or remotely in the United States.
ROLE AND RESPONSIBILITIES
What you'll do at Figma:
- Bridge design and code: Own how designs become production-ready code, and how code changes flow back onto the Figma canvas — building a round-trip that's increasingly powered by agents rather than manual handoff.
- Raise the bar on our MCP server: Drive the quality and performance of the platform developers rely on today, making it faster and more capable as more of product development shifts into code.
- Build for continuous quality: Define the evals and infrastructure that measure how well we translate between design and code, so the experience gets measurably better week over week.
- Grow with our customers: Expand adoption while developing a deep understanding of enterprise workflows, and deliver output that teams can trust at scale.
BASIC QUALIFICATIONS
We'd love to hear from you if you have:
- 5+ years in product management, owning products from concept through launch
- Shipped measurable quality improvements to a product — and can point to the metrics that moved and how you moved them
- The ability to read and reason about code, and to hold your own in technical design discussions on how AI systems (agents, LLMs, MCP) work
- Led a cross-functional team through delivery of a major initiative end to end, including presenting outcomes to executives
- Experience working directly with enterprise customers to understand their workflows and turn what you learn into shipped product
- Background building design tools, developer tools, or AI-powered coding products

Target roles aligned with your visa category
Figma sponsors E-3 visas for Australian citizens and H-1B1 visa for Singaporean and Chilean nationals. If you hold one of these passports, flag it in outreach, these categories bypass the H-1B lottery and can simplify the employer's decision.
Confirm your OPT timeline before final rounds
If you're on F-1 OPT, calculate exactly how much work authorization remains before accepting an offer. Figma will need time to file an H-1B or arrange a cap-exempt bridge, entering final rounds with under 60 days left creates real risk.

Understand what PERM means for your timeline
If you're targeting a Green Card through Figma, the PERM labor certification process requires DOL to verify no qualified U.S. workers were available. For PM roles at a high-profile tech company, this recruitment documentation phase can take six to twelve months before USCIS even sees your petition.
Get clarity on sponsorship scope during the offer stage
Before signing, confirm in writing whether Figma will cover employer-side USCIS filing fees and whether they support both H-1B and immigrant visa petitions for this role. PM offers sometimes move fast, nail down sponsorship scope before you're past the negotiation window.

Which visa types does Figma use for Product Manager roles?
Figma sponsors H-1B, H-1B1 visa, E-3, and F-1 OPT extensions for Product Managers at the nonimmigrant level, and supports EB-2 and EB-3 immigrant visa pathways for longer-term sponsorship. Australian citizens benefit from the E-3 category, which has no lottery and allows two-year renewable periods, making it a practical starting point for Figma PM candidates from Australia.

How do I time a sponsored PM offer at Figma with the H-1B cap cycle?
USCIS opens H-1B registration each March for an April 1 start date. If you receive a Figma offer outside that window and aren't H-1B exempt, you'll either need to wait for the next cap cycle or explore a cap-exempt bridge arrangement. Starting your job search at least six months before your current work authorization expires gives you enough runway to align an offer with USCIS filing deadlines without pressure.
